It must also be pointed out that South Korea has pretty potent laws in opposition to medications. If caught, you could possibly be deported or maybe sentenced to up to 5 years in jail for mere possession. The very best suggestions would be to keep away from all medication apart from caffeine, alcohol, and tobacco.

South Korean customs emphasize interactions in the two individual and business enterprise lifetime, Specially between persons and their elders. When ingesting collectively, the youngest on the table is predicted to serve Absolutely everyone else.
